Diagnosis of mesenteric panniculitis in the multi-detector computed tomography era. Association with malignancy and surgical history.

The prevalence of MP in patients with prior abdomino-pelvic surgery was 9.2% (44/476) versus 1.1% (46/4282) in patients without prior abdomino-pelvic surgery, a statistically highly significant difference ( p =0.0001).
